Почему Chrome для iOS по-разному обрабатывает файлы cookie? - PullRequest
0 голосов
/ 01 февраля 2019

Как правило, Google Chrome не позволяет переопределять файлы cookie через незащищенные соединения.

Если вы используете Chrome в Windows / Mac / Android и пытаетесь переопределить безопасный файл cookie через незащищенное соединение,безопасные cookie-файлы остаются на месте.

Но Chrome на iOS переопределяет cookie-файлы в такой ситуации, которая представляет угрозу безопасности.

Почему Chrome для iOS ведет себя по-разному?

ЕслиВы хотите проверить это сами, а затем посетите три URL-адреса ниже.Первый запишет безопасный cookie, второй попытается переопределить тот же cookie по незащищенному соединению, третий отобразит результат:

Я проверял это на:

  • Chrome 72 в Windows (безопасный)
  • Chrome 72 в Mac(безопасный)
  • Chrome 71 на Android (безопасный)
  • Chrome 72 на iOS (небезопасный)

1 Ответ

0 голосов
/ 05 февраля 2019

Chrome на iOS - это всего лишь тонкая оболочка вокруг WkWebView от Apple.Как следствие, он ведет себя почти так же, как Safari от Apple, потому что Google не может использовать свои собственные реализации Blink и Chrome Networking из-за правил Apple AppStore.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...